Consortium for Clinical Research and Innovation Singapore is hiring a full-time Client Service Coordinator to be the first point of contact for clients. Responsibilities include managing communications, scheduling appointments, and supporting patients' admission and discharge processes.
Ideal candidates should have a passion for animals, excellent communication skills, and prior experience in customer service. The position offers a supportive work culture and includes relocation assistance if applicable.

How to prepare for a job interview at Consortium for Clinical Research and Innovation Singapore
✨Know Your Stuff About Pet Care
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of pet care and the specific services offered by the company. Being able to discuss animal behaviour, common health issues, and how to handle different types of pets will show your passion and expertise.
✨Show Off Your Communication Skills
Since this role involves a lot of client interaction, practice articulating your thoughts clearly and confidently. You might want to prepare for common customer service scenarios and think about how you would handle them effectively.
✨Be Ready to Discuss Your Experience
Think about your previous roles in customer service and how they relate to this position. Be prepared to share specific examples of how you've successfully managed client communications or resolved issues in the past.
✨Ask Thoughtful Questions
Prepare some questions that show your interest in the role and the company culture. Asking about team dynamics or how they support their staff can demonstrate that you're not just looking for any job, but that you're genuinely interested in being part of their team.
